Description
General part information
IO-TXLR4-F
IO-TXLR4-F is a 4 pin Tiny XLR female connector. This locking 4 pin cable connector with gold plated pins and solder cups for audio, lighting control, industrial automation, and test equipment. The Tiny XLR connector is designed to maintain interoperability with industry equipment and footprints. This Tiny XLR cable connector features a durable locking mechanism and offer a threaded housing assembly for ease of use. This feature also gives a user the ability to make quick fixes on the job without complete disassembly. It also features precision machined one-piece gold plated contacts to maintain signal integrity. The connector is keyed to ensure proper polarity and avoid incorrect mating.
